Part two of our dog saga. As you all know, we lost our lovely dog, Gizmo, almost three weeks ago now. Our other dog, Misty, has never been without him. The first couple of days after we lost him, she was totally fine, but the third day she took a turn. She was moping around, crying at the door, whihing randomly and looking for him the whole day. You could realy tell that she was grieving, which was heartbreaking. The following day I was back at work as was Amy, and Amy’s sister and friend were kind enough to come and look after Misty for the day.
That night we got a new addition to our family. This is Loki. Loki is a Border Collie cross Cocker Spaniel and he is a little handful! When we first brought him home, Misty and him were equally as scared of eachother! But they were soon playing and at present they are the absolute best of friends. She has perked up ten fold since having a little buddy to look after. It seems she is making quite the wonderful big sister.
We chose his name because Loki is the god of mischief, and we sometimes call Misty misdemeanor. He is currently living up to his name one hundred percent and is into absolutely everything. Today he caught sight of his own reflection in the glass fireplace and barked at it for fifteen minutes…
He’s not a replacement for Gizmo, but he is helping to heal the wound left behind by the loss of our darling boy. Hopefully Loki will become just as treasured a member of the family as Gizmo was and will always be.
